#baca72 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#baca72 is composed of 72.9% red, 79.2% green and 44.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 7.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 43.6% yellow and 20.8% black. It has a hue angle of 70.9 degrees, a saturation of 45.4% and a lightness of 62%. #baca72 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ffe4 with #759500. Closest websafe color is: #cccc66.

Shades and Tints of #baca72

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010201 is the darkest color, while #f9faf2 is the lightest one.
